Impact
A buffer overflow occurs when the acl_general_setup Edit ACE function copies a user-supplied name field into a fixed-size buffer without validating its length. The vulnerability is specifically a CWE‑120 flaw. If an attacker successfully triggers the overflow they can either crash the web management service for a denial of service or, at a minimum, inject and execute arbitrary commands on the device.
Affected Systems
The issue affects a wide range of DrayTek VigorSwitch devices, including the FX2120, G1280, G1282, G2100, G2121, G2280x, G2282x, G2540x, G2540xs, G2542x, P1280, P1281x, P1282, P2100, P2121, P2280x, P2282x, P2540x, P2540xs, P2542x, P2542xh, PQ2121x, PQ2200xb, PQ2300xb, PX2060, Q2121x, Q2200x, and Q2300x. No specific firmware versions were listed as affected, so all current releases should be considered vulnerable until patches are applied.
Risk and Exploitability
The CVSS score of 8.6 classifies the flaw as high severity. The EPSS score is not available, and the vulnerability is not listed in the CISA KEV catalog, indicating limited publicly known exploitation. However, the vulnerability requires valid administrative credentials to the device's web interface, meaning only authenticated users can attempt exploitation. The likely attack vector is a remote attacker submitting crafted input through the web GUI to trigger a buffer overflow, leading to service disruption or code execution.
